Lobo e Falcao Reserva 2019

José Lobo de Vasconcelos’ regular Lobo e Falcão is one of our best-selling Portuguese reds. Naturally, when he offered to send his special Reserva release – the flagship red of his historic Quinta do Casal Branco estate – we eagerly accepted.

Named in honor of José’s surname and his family’s history as royal falconers, Lobo e Falcão is crafted with hand-selected parcels of Alicante Bouschet (prized for its rare red flesh, which imparts extra depth and color), Syrah, Touriga Nacional (star Port grape), and Cabernet Sauvignon from José’s low-yielding, old vines. After fermentation in lagares (open stone tanks traditionally used in Port production), the wine spent 12 months in fine French barrels.

The result is a complex, well-balanced, and intensely flavored Reserva. Look for perfumed floral aromas mingling with ripe dark fruit and toasty vanilla oak. Rich, forest-fruit flavors dominate the succulent, well balanced palate. Hints of mocha-spice grace the long, smooth finish. Try it with barbecued meats, tomato- and bean-based stews, and other hearty dishes.
